Spring at the Mayakovsky House Museum
Spring at the Mayakovsky House Museum is a spring in Imereti, Georgia. Spring at the Mayakovsky House Museum is situated nearby to Vladimir Mayakovski House-Museum, as well as near the village Zeda Dimi.Places of Interest Nearby

Bagdat’i
Town
Photo: Island,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Baghdati is a town of 3,700 people in the Imereti region of western Georgia, at the edge of the Ajameti forest on the river Khanistsqali, a tributary of the Rioni.
